Unlike older keys that only use the lock cylinder, modern Mazda keys for cars have a transponder chip built into them. This small electronic device emits code which is detected by the vehicle's engine control unit. If the code is correct, it allows the driver to open the door lock and start the vehicle. If it isn't then the engine will not start and the car will be locked out.

This technology can be a nightmare if need a replacement key. The majority of dealerships require proof ownership and will charge a significant fee for the service. A locksmith from your local area, however usually, can complete the same thing for less cost.

Transponder Keys

As opposed to traditional keys, transponder car keys are equipped with security chips that transmit an alarm to the immobilizer. This signal is used to prevent the car from starting in the event of theft or attempted tampering. This kind of key requires a locksmith as well as special tools to duplicate. Keyless Entry System

As opposed to mechanical keys of the past, modern Mazda keys are equipped with a keyless entry system which offers a high level of security against theft. These systems are designed to stop unauthorised use of your vehicle by transmitting a security code to the engine control unit (ECU) when you press the key fob button.

The ECU will not start your vehicle in the event that the code is incorrect. This is a very effective protection against theft, however it does mean that you must be extremely careful regarding where you put your key fob since it could still lock and unlock your car even if you are not present.

Remotes

Every modern car from the Holden Commodore to the latest Mazda 3 comes with a key fob. It's convenient to have one, but it can be costly to lose them. Dealerships can duplicate and create a duplicate key for you, but it will cost you - typically around $220 for entry-level models, and even more for top brands. Locksmiths can complete the job for less than half the price.

Some CHOICE members say they are stung by high costs when they lose their keys, or when the plastic hook holding them to their key ring snaps. Edward says he had to pay more than $200 to get his key fob replaced because the hook on his key snapped off, and the dealership was unable to open his key.
